La
Belle Alliance Deluxe Rooms
& Blues Wing Deluxe The deluxe rooms are located in the 'La Belle Alliance' wing as well as in our latest addition the 'Blues' wing. These rooms all have AC, television, telephone, in-room safe, balcony or terrase and a private bathrooms with bathtub. Some of the deluxe rooms have kitchenette and all rooms have a small refrigerator with minibar and coffee/tea amenities, a clock radio, modem connection, iron with ironing board and a hairdryer. These rooms have sea view or sea view/ garden view. |
| Moderate rooms The Moderate rooms are located in our 'Classic Avila' wing. The rooms all have AC, television, telephone and a private bathroom with shower and hairdryer. The rooms are quite small, which is why we can only acommodate a max. of two adults in here. The rooms have two twin beds or one queen size bed. The Moderate and
Preferred rooms are sill
on the Curaçao water
system, which means that the sun heats up the water.

Preferred
rooms The Preferred rooms are located in our original wing. The spacious rooms all have AC, television, telephone, a private bathroom with shower and hairdryer and a minibar. In the preferred rooms we can acommodate a max. of two adults and one child or three adults. These rooms also have twin beds or one queen size bed. |
| 1
or 2 Bedroom Suites The suites are located in the 'La Belle Alliance' wing and have AC, a living rooms with television, telephone and balcony. The open kitchen is equipped with microwave and dishwasher. The suites have a separate bedroom with private bathroom and bath. In an one bedroom suite an additional bed can be placed upon request (extra charge) making a suite for a max. of three persons. A two bedroom suite has an additional bedroom with bathroom. A max. of five people van stay here. |
